Designing Basement Waterproofing Systems

Basements are susceptible to the ingress of moisture and contaminants from the ground. For this reason, a waterproofing system will usually be required. Guidance on the requirements for basement waterproofing systems is given in BS 8102:2022 “Code of practice for protection of below-ground structures against water from the ground”.

Designing a Basement Waterproofing System

The choice of waterproofing system will depend on a number of factors such as the method & type of basement construction, the depth below ground, and the proposed end use. Ventilation

In addition to dampness from the ground, basements are also commonly affected by condensation issues due to moisture-laden air within the basement structure. For this reason, the waterproofing systems described in this guide will usually need to be supplemented by mechanical ventilation. Type-A, Type-B or Type-C Waterproofing?

According to BS 8102:2022, basement waterproofing system materials fall into 3 main categories (referred to as ‘Types’).

Type C – Drained Protection

Type C waterproofing collects groundwater through a cavity membrane and cavity drainage system. The cavity membrane controls the flow of groundwater. The cavity drainage system carries it away from the basement and disposes of it away from the below-ground structure.
